أَنَّهُ سَمِعَ أَبَا ع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ع يَقُولُ‌ يُسْأَلُ الرَّجُلُ فِي قَبْرِهِ فَإِذَا أَثْبَتَ فُسِحَ لَهُ فِي قَبْرِهِ سَبْعَةَ أَذْرُعٍ وَ فُتِحَ لَهُ بَابٌ إِلَى الْجَنَّةِ وَ قِيلَ لَهُ نَمْ نَوْمَةَ الْعَرُوسِ قَرِيرَ الْعَيْنِ.

“I heard ab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), say that a man is interrogated in his grave. If he remains steadfast (in his belief), his grave is then made spacious by nine yards, a door to paradise is then opened for him and it is said to him, ‘Rest to sleep like a newly wedded person with delightful heart.’”

قَالَ أَبُو ع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ع‌ إِنَّ أَرْوَاحَ الْمُؤْمِنِينَ لَفِي شَجَرَةٍ مِنَ الْجَنَّةِ يَأْكُلُونَ مِنْ طَعَامِهَا وَ يَشْرَبُونَ مِنْ شَرَابِهَا وَ يَقُولُونَ رَبَّنَا أَقِمِ السَّاعَةَ لَنَا وَ أَنْجِزْ لَنَا مَا وَعَدْتَنَا وَ أَلْحِقْ آخِرَنَا بِأَوَّلِنَا.

“Ab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), has said, ‘The souls of the believing people are in a tree of paradise. They eat and drink of fruits and water thereof, and say, “O Lord, make the Day of Judgment to come for us, make what You had promised to come true and allow the last of us to join our first.’””

سَأَلْ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ع عَنْ أَرْوَاحِ الْمُؤْمِنِينَ فَقَالَ فِي حُجُرَاتٍ فِي الْجَنَّةِ يَأْكُلُونَ مِنْ طَعَامِهَا وَ يَشْرَبُونَ مِنْ شَرَابِهَا وَ يَقُولُونَ رَبَّنَا أَقِمِ السَّاعَةَ لَنَا وَ أَنْجِزْ لَنَا مَا وَعَدْتَنَا وَ أَلْحِقْ آخِرَنَا بِأَوَّلِنَا.

“I once asked ab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), about the souls (spirits) of believing people. He said, ‘They are in chambers in paradise, they eat and drink thereof and say, “O Lord, make it the Day of Judgment, allow what You had promised us to come true and join the last of us with those who were first.’””

سَأَلْ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ع عَنْ جَنَّةِ آدَمَ ع فَقَالَ جَنَّةٌ مِنْ جِنَانِ الدُّنْيَا تَطْلُعُ فِيهَا الشَّمْسُ وَ الْقَمَرُ وَ لَوْ كَانَتْ مِنْ جِنَانِ الْآخِرَةِ مَا خَرَجَ مِنْهَا أَبَداً.

“I asked ab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), about the garden of Adam (a.s.). He said, ‘It was a garden of the gardens of the world on which the sun and moon rise. Had it been of the gardens of the hereafter, he would have never been expelled there from.’”

قَالَ أَبُو جَعْفَرٍ ع‌ لَا تَنْسَوُا الْمُوجِبَتَيْنِ أَوْ قَالَ عَلَيْكُمْ بِالْمُوجِبَتَيْنِ فِي دُبُرِ كُلِ‌ صَلَاةٍ قُلْتُ وَ مَا الْمُوجِبَتَانِ‌[1] قَالَ تَسْأَلُ اللَّهَ الْجَنَّةَ وَ تَعُوذُ بِاللَّهِ مِنَ النَّارِ.

‘Do not forget’ - or that he said ‘you must not forget appealing before Allah after every obligatory Salah (prayer) about the two essential matters.’ I then asked, ‘What are the two essential matters?’ The Imam replied, ‘Appealing before Allah for paradise and seeking refuge with Allah against the fire.”’
